小编wal*_*jue的帖子

运营商优先?

String ntohl(int i)
{
    int i1 = i % (256);
    int i2 = (i %(65536))/(256);
    int i3 = (i %(16777216))/(65536);
    int i4 = (i)/(16777216);

    int i5 = i % (2^8);
    int i6 = (i %(2^16))/(2^8);
    int i7 = (i %(2^24))/(2^16);
    int i8 = i/(2^24);

    Log.d(TAG, "i:"+i+"   "+i1+"."+i2+"."+i3+"."+i4);
    Log.d(TAG, "i:"+i+"   "+i5+"."+i6+"."+i7+"."+i8);
    return ""+i1+"."+i2+"."+i3+"."+i4;
}
Run Code Online (Sandbox Code Playgroud)

嗨,

我有一个上面列出的方法,它返回一个ipv4地址.我已经完成了计算,但i5 i6 i7 i8与i1 i2 i3 i4不同.

java operators

1
推荐指数
2
解决办法
281
查看次数

标签 统计

java ×1

operators ×1